To me, one of the functions of a live-in slave is to be able to handle things and run a household or at least to prioritize and handle a list of items. In order to do this, the slave has to have the where-with-all to get things done, and done correctly, while juggling people's personalities and what not. This usually means the slave will be of dominant personality. But, having a dominant personality doesn't make you any more a slave than it does a Master (and vice versa). It's the heart, the chosen path and the spiritual journey that does. Or at least for me, it does.

While I think I understand where you're coming from, Elegant, for me, it would depend on the intent of the group as to if I thought it was appropriate for slaves to have a leadership role. If the group is a support group for Dominants/Masters, then the Dominants/Masters should take the responsibility of leadership. It's not an exclusionary issue; it's one of responsibility. Likewise, if it's a group for submissives/slaves, then the subs/slaves obviously should run their group. Each group can choose to involved others and to what extent.

One of the groups I'm an officer of, for example, is a Female Dominant support group. We have chosen to invite those that serve us to be a part of this group and we listen to what they have to say and ask for their opinions, but, the final decisions about the running of the group are ours. It's OUR support group, hence we feel that the responsibility for it lies in us, not someone else. On the flip side, I know of a submissive/slave support group which totally excludes us Dominant/Master types. I often make referrals as I feel this is an excellent idea. It offers a “safe haven” where subs and slave can share amongst themselves without the worries of protocol and such.

But, if we're talking about the leather community at large, then certainly we each should have the opportunity to lead. The community at large is designed to support both Dominants/Masters and submissives/slaves, so each should be able to offer their skills. Goodness knows we have so few good leaders to go around.

I think really, it's the differance between those of us who are part of the BDSM fantasy vs. those of us who are part of the BDSM reality.

I think the negativity that seems to sometimes surround "Dominant Slaves" stems from perception. The fantasy says that 'subs/slaves/bottoms' are whispy, waify women, always ready to be taken, always supplicant to everyone, that Doms are always all knowing, firm, in control and take what they want when they want it.

The BDSM reality is that everyone wants to throw a party, have an event and or have a good organization, however, being able to organize those things often falls on the shoulders of a few who are willing, and have the internal fortitude to see these projects through. When bottoms/subs/slaves end up the very people who can harness that task and take the responsibility to see it through, it can often cause a degree of resentment within the group.

Been there, done that. And it does make it difficult, especially if you are a single sub/bottom/slave vs. a partnered/owned one. And people can be just as shitty in BDSM as they are in any given vanilla setting too.

I think that the bottom line is (no pun intended), in any given group, vanilla or BDSM/kink/leather, there are doers and talkers. And while the doers are doing the heavy lifting, the talkers often like to criticize while they stand around watching the doers do.

So, Elegant darlin, there is no shame in being a well organized, thoughtful person who is willing to see a project through for the grater good of the community. Without people like you and me and others who, regardless of their Kink orientation, are willing to put our time and effort into making things happen for our community, it would be kinda dull around here ;)

I think being a leader in the lifestyle has much less to do with orientation than it does have to do with being an outstanding human being.
